360 was rushed and has bugs, like the "Red Ring of Death", but at the moment has a superior list of games, with Bioshock, Devil May Cry 4 and the like. PS3 is better hardware-wise but the list of games is a bit lower in quality. That, however, will change in the coming months the impending release of some high profile franchises like Gran Turismo 5, Metal Gear Solid 4 and Final Fantasy 13.

The only advantage I can see with the PS3 is the Blu Ray player. Now, I don't have an HD TV or have any intention of getting one, so there's no point in getting a PS3.

Funnily enough, when I bought the 360, the shop offered me an XBox HDDVD player for $20. Bargain.... If HDDVD had defeated Blu Ray.

Given there are more games and the XBox is cheaper by probably at least $250, I'd find justification for the PS3 pretty hard.
